    <description>A refund claim under the SAD exemption notification turned on whether a Chartered Accountant&#039;s certificate was a mandatory precondition and whether the earlier certificate&#039;s authenticity doubt justified recovery. The Tribunal noted that the certificate was not a condition precedent under the notification, no ulterior motive by the importer was established, and a fresh certificate had been produced for verification. Relying on precedent involving the same issue, it held that the proper course was to remand the matter so the adjudicating authority could verify the certificate and supporting documents before reconsidering the refund claim.</description>
